Score 91-93/100 · Drink 2023-2045, Neal Martin, Jan 2019

The 2017 Chambertin Grand Cru has a tight-lipped bouquet that demands coaxing from the glass; the 80% whole bunches imparts captivating undergrowth/damp moss aromas that filter through the black fruit. The palate is medium-bodied and quite dense, with grippy tannin and a light espresso note. I find the Mazis-Chambertin has a little more grace on the finish by direct comparison. A bit of a curmudgeon, this will benefit from four or five years in bottle.

Score 18.5/20 · Drink 2027-2045, Julia Harding MW, jancisrobinson.com, Dec 2018

Frosted in 2016. Five barrels, two new. Magnums and bottles. Barrel sample. Deep crimson. Sweet, ripe and intensely fruited on the nose. A hint of vanilla over crushed strawberries laced with pepper. Spicy too. Cool customer, less open on the palate. Pure, cool and silky on the palate. Incredible finesse already and so much more to come. Soaring beauty even if not yet expressive. (JH)
